Chelsea: Why Boehly shouldn’t sack Potter – Victor Ikpeba

Date:

Former AS Monaco striker, Victor Ikpeba has called on Chelsea, under the leadership of co-owner Todd Boehly, not to sack manager Graham Potter because the Blues have turned the corner.

There were calls for Boehly to sack Potter in February following Chelsea’s poor form of results in the Premier League.

Chelsea were only able to score one Premier League goal last month but have turned the corner with an aggregate win over two legs against Borussia Dortmund in the Champions League round of 16 as well as victories over Leeds United and Leicester City in the domestic league.

Speaking on Monday Night Football broadcast by SuperSport, Ikpeba wants Potter to remain as Chelsea manager, adding that he needs time at Stamford Bridge.

Ikpeba said, “I think Graham Potter should remain as manager of Chelsea because they’ve turned the corner. What a relief for the fans.

“The Chelsea fans have suffered a lot in the past few weeks. The results have been diabolic with the quality of players they’ve with the money that they spent to bring these players to Chelsea.

“Three technically brilliant goals [against Leicester City]. We should not forget Kai Havertz’s touch from nowhere to score one of the goals. It is not easy to score that kind of goal in that situation.

“It just shows the approach to get to the next level. But bringing these qualities together takes time and I feel the manager needs time. Maybe he needs another season.”
